No, not really though the real origins are no less brutal. It is said that from 13th to 14th February, the Romans celebrated the feast of Lupercalia. 

This was a very ancient annual pastoral festival observed in the city of Rome to avert evil spirits and purify the city, releasing health and fertility amongst its inhabitants.

As with many such celebrations, Emperor Claudius II took things too far by executing two men who had each been named Valentine. Their martyrdom was honored by the Catholic Church with the celebration of St. Valentine's Day.

A hearty meal

http://www.stokessauces.co.uk/page/sauces/ketchup-and-saucesBeef hearts cooked properly are full of flavour and so so tender. For this very simple recipe, use 2 kg of beef heart.
First wash the meat, removing any fat and arteries (your butcher should do this for you). Cut them in half and then into 1cm slices. Toss the meat in seasoned flour and brown quickly for a minute in foaming butter.

Put the browned meat in a casserole with a sliced onion, chopped carrot, swede, celery and a couple of sprigs of fresh thyme. Pour in 250 ml of beef stock, 125 ml of red wine with 2 tbsp of Stokes Brown Sauce and 1 tbsp of Cider & Horseradish Mustard. Bring to the boil and simmer gently for 1 1/2 to 2 hours.

It's fantastic with buttered kale and mashed potatoes with Stokes Creamed Horseradish Sauce.
